If it's your first video then you did a good job with the beat and you flow's....but I wish you guys coulda went harder with the lyrics....throw in some real quotable lines....things about chicago...yadda yadda.
The video quality I feel was great but if your gonna make a "southside chi-town" video you coulda thrown in some black and white shots more often, and some parts of the video coulda been cut....the outside of the church could just been you entering the big doors of the church and walking down the aisle for instance.
I felt you could done more with the video. You gotta make a good first impression....more nun-hookers, posting up by someones nice ferrari/lambo/maserati, coulda rapped near some murals or graffiti.
Of course this is just from my perspective. If being a Chi-town rapper is your thing you should look at other rappers from your city and how they do their videos and ask yourself if you want to make something similar (i.e. lil durk) or different (i.e. Lupe).
